Marino primarily made his money through acting on popular TV shows and films. His work in comedy, particularly on series like “Party Down,” “Childrens Hospital,” and guest roles on big network comedies, has been a reliable source of earnings. Beyond acting, Marino has expanded into writing and directing, which bolsters his income through behind-the-scenes revenue.

He’s also benefited from recurring roles on television, which generally provide more stability and residuals than one-off appearances. His comedy troupe origins with The State helped launch his career, but it’s his solo projects in TV and film where the bulk of his earnings lie. Marino’s involvement in developing and producing projects adds a recurring income dimension beyond acting fees alone.

His biggest paydays came from long-running TV roles with solid fan followings, especially “Party Down,” which garnered a cult audience and critical praise. While his per-episode fees are not publicly disclosed, sources suggest lead roles in shows of similar profile typically pay in the low to mid-six figures annually. Directing assignments on episodes of respected comedies have likely added significant earnings as well.
